Edible Eco-Activist Attacks

UK Business Secretary Peter Mandelson Hit With Green Custard

In an act of fury and local eco-activism, Leila Deen, an activist from a campaign group called Plane Stupid, threw a cup of slimy green custard in the face of UK Business Secretary Peter Mandelson as he stepped out of his car yesterday.

The shower of custard was a reaction to reports that said Lord Mandelson had met with lobbyists from Heathrow airport owner BAA before the government decided to give the much-debated yes to a third runway at the London airport.
